B and Bs in Earls Court

Ambassadors Hotel
16 Collingham Road
Earls Court
London

SW5 0LX
Website

Write a review
Book Now

In stylish Kensington, Ambassadors Hotel is situated just off Cromwell Road and the famous Museum Mile. The hotel features a 24-hour front desk and modern rooms with free Wi-Fi access for 30 minutes per day. A free tour of London is provided with every booking. Ambassadors Hotel is just a 5-minute walk from Earl’s Court Underground Station, and Harrods is a 20-minute walk. Hyde Park and the Royal Albert Hall are just a 15-minute walk away. A private bathroom and tea/coffee facilities are featured in each room at Ambassadors Hotel, as well as a TV, telephone and hairdryer. The spacious Peel Bar offers light snacks and beverages, and features computers for guests’ use. Cooked breakfasts are served daily in the hotel restaurant, and continental breakfasts are also available. A 55% discount at a local spa and gym is offered to all guests.

Facilities

Credit Cards Accepted
TV in Rooms
Night Porter

local taxis | local restaurants | local pubs

This page viewed on 4,888 occasions since Oct 16th 2005

Brit Quote:
Cynicism is humour in ill health. - H G Wells
More Quotes

On this day:
Great Fire of London 1212 - 1212, Nelson Loses Eye - 1794, First Briton Killed in Aircraft Accident - 1910, Debut of the Rolling Stones - 1962
More dates from British history

click here to view all the British counties

County Pages